Resogun PS3 Release Date Set On December 23 Along With PS Vita Version; PS4 Version Will Be Avaialble Next Year!

The Sony PlayStation has formally announced the Resogun PS3 release date.

In the report of the Franchise Herald, the Resogun PS3 release date is set on December 23 along with the PS Vita version of the game.

According to the report of Polygon, the Resogun PS3 and PS Vita will be released before Christmas for about $14.99.

 "I'm pleased to announce today that Resogun is coming to PS3 and PS Vita for $14.99. That's right Resofans, starting December 23rd you'll be able to save the last humans anywhere, anytime," according to Pedro Souza on PlayStation Blog spot.

"Duly, the biggest technical difference is that the PS Vita and PS3 games run at 30 instead of 60 frames per second. This was a very difficult decision to consider, but a very necessary one to allow the team to focus on what was possible and to make the best game possible for both of these platforms," he wrote

The PS3 and PS Vita games feature a cross save functionality, it can let players share their progress in between both platforms.

Furthermore, the PS Vita, according to PlayStation Blog will feature an "ad-hoc co-op" that can let players team up with a friend. "It Also makes use of the touch features so you can fully customize the controls, using either the face buttons or the touch control for any action possible," according to PlayStation Blog.

Meanwhile, the Resogun PS4 version will be coming next year with the new Expansion Pack, according to Franchise Herald.
